Mata was born October 25, 1914, in Black Hawk County,
IA, the daughter of Henry and Katherine (Koehler) Landau. She
received her education in Waterloo, Iowa and graduated
from West High School. On February 26, 1935, at Peace
United Church of Christ in Fredericksburg, she married
Everett W. Steege. To this union four children were
born.
The couple farmed south of Fredericksburg their
entire lives. Everett died on October 9, 2002 and in
July of 2007, Mata moved from their farm to reside at
the New Hampton Care Center. She enjoyed knitting,
crocheting and making ceramics.
